+\u001B[1mDESCRIPTION\u001B[0m
+ The goal of the JAXB project is to develop and evolve the code base for
the Reference of JAXB, the Java Architecture
+ for XML Binding. The JAXB specification is developed through the Java
Community Process following the process
+ described at jcp.org. This process involves an Expert Group with a lead
that is responsible for delivering the
+ specification, a reference implementation (RI) and a Technology
Compatibility Kit (TCK). The primary goal of an RI
+ is to support the development of the specification and to validate it.
Specific RIs can have additional goals;
+ the JAXB RI is a production-quality implementation that is used directly
in a number of products by Oracle and
+ other vendors.
+
+ The JAXB expert group has wide industry participation with Oracle as the
EG lead. The initial specification
+ (JAXB 1.0) was JSR-31 and was released in March 2003.
+
+ The next versions of the spec (JAXB 2.0/2.1/2.2/2.3) are being developed
as JSR-222; this release addresses a number
+ of additional requirements in the area, and increases the synergy between
the JAXB and JAX-WS specifications.
+
+ The supported standards are:
+ * JAXB 2.0/2.1/2.2/2.3
+ * W3C XML Schema
+ * XML DTD
